Long Term Rental (BRRRR)
A long-term investment strategy that involves Buying a property, Renovating, Renting, Refinancing it, and Repeating the procedure by employing the cash from the refinance is called BRRRR. BRRRR is a system for continuous expansion. A key piece of this program is to be able to do a “cash-out” refinance.
You improve the value of the asset beyond the amount you spent acquiring and fixing the asset. Then you receive a cash-out mortgage refinance loan that is computed on the superior value, and you take out the balance. You use that cash to buy an additional home and the procedure starts anew. You acquire more and more rental homes and constantly expand your lease revenues.

Short-Term Rental Cash-on-Cash Return
Cash-on-cash return is a means to estimate the value of an investment. Divide the Net Operating Income (NOI) by the total amount of cash put in. The result you get is a percentage. The higher it is, the more quickly your investment will be repaid and you’ll begin gaining profits. Loan-assisted ventures will have a stronger cash-on-cash return because you will be investing less of your capital.
Average Short-Term Rental Capitalization (Cap) Rates
One measurement conveys the value of a property as a revenue-producing asset — average short-term rental capitalization (cap) rate. An income-generating asset that has a high cap rate and charges market rental rates has a high market value. If cap rates are low, you can assume to spend more for real estate in that location. You can calculate the cap rate for potential investment real estate by dividing the Net Operating Income (NOI) by the Fair Market Value or listing price of the property. This gives you a percentage that is the per-annum return, or cap rate.

Wholesaling
In real estate wholesaling, you search for a residential property that investors may consider a lucrative investment opportunity and sign a sale and purchase agreement to purchase it. An investor then “buys” the purchase contract from you. The real buyer then completes the transaction. You are selling the rights to the contract, not the property itself.

Mortgage Note Investing
Mortgage note investing includes buying debt (mortgage note) from a mortgage holder at a discount. This way, you become the mortgage lender to the initial lender’s client.
Performing loans are mortgage loans where the debtor is regularly on time with their payments. Performing loans earn you long-term passive income. Non-performing notes can be re-negotiated or you can buy the collateral for less than face value via a foreclosure procedure.

Foreclosure Laws
Experienced mortgage note investors are thoroughly aware of their state’s regulations concerning foreclosure. Many states utilize mortgage documents and some use Deeds of Trust. A mortgage dictates that the lender goes to court for approval to start foreclosure. A Deed of Trust permits you to file a public notice and proceed to foreclosure.

Property Taxes
Usually, lenders collect the house tax payments from the homeowner each month. So the lender makes sure that the taxes are submitted when payable. If the borrower stops performing, unless the mortgage lender takes care of the taxes, they won’t be paid on time. Tax liens leapfrog over any other liens.
If property taxes keep going up, the client’s mortgage payments also keep growing. This makes it hard for financially strapped homeowners to make their payments, so the loan could become past due.

Syndications
A syndication means a group of investors who merge their money and abilities to invest in property. One partner arranges the investment and invites the others to invest.
The coordinator of the syndication is called the Syndicator or Sponsor. It is their job to conduct the purchase or creation of investment real estate and their operation. The Sponsor oversees all business issues including the distribution of income.
The other investors are passive investors. The partnership promises to give them a preferred return once the business is turning a profit. These investors have no right (and thus have no duty) for making business or property supervision decisions.

REITs
A trust owning income-generating properties and that offers shares to the public is a REIT — Real Estate Investment Trust. REITs were developed to permit average investors to invest in real estate. The average investor has the funds to invest in a REIT.
Shareholders in real estate investment trusts are completely passive investors. The risk that the investors are taking is diversified among a collection of investment properties. Investors can liquidate their REIT shares anytime they want. Something you can’t do with REIT shares is to choose the investment properties. Their investment is confined to the real estate properties owned by the REIT.
Real Estate Investment Funds
A Real Estate Investment Fund is a mutual fund that holds stocks of real estate firms. The fund does not own real estate — it owns interest in real estate companies. These funds make it doable for a wider variety of investors to invest in real estate. Funds aren’t obligated to pay dividends unlike a REIT. The value of a fund to someone is the projected growth of the price of its shares.
You can select a fund that focuses on a selected category of real estate you are familiar with, but you do not get to select the geographical area of every real estate investment. Your decision as an investor is to choose a fund that you rely on to handle your real estate investments.
